Each year the European Centre for Space Law organises, together with the International Institute of Space Law (IISL), the European Round of the Manfred Lachs Space Law Moot Court Competition. Regional winners from Europe, Asia-Pacific and the United States then compete in the world finals, held in conjunction with the annual International Astronautical Congress. After having hosted the event for many years in the premises of ESA Headquarters, ECSL decided to organise it each year in a University in Europe in order to promote this competition and spread the knowledge of space law all over Europe. Thus, the European Round was successfully organised in in Riga, Lithuania (2008), in Athens, Greece (2009) and in Györ, Hungary (2010).

As a matter of policy, the ECSL selects some teams to reimburse travel and accommodation expenses for two students per team. The selection of teams who qualify for this financial support is based on the scores of their written memorials and/or the financial possibilities of their University. Teams who do not qualify for ECSL's financial support may also take part in the regional round at their own expense. No registration fees are required to enter the competition.
